Turbojugend Designs

History...

When I started this site in August 2000 I didn't really know who or what the Turbojugend was. I did know, however, that this monster introduced to me back in '96 was Turbonegro had me obsessed. At any rate, it didn't take long to figure out that this was the Turbonegro fan club and that I needed to create something custom for the Turbojugend USA web site. Shortly after debuting this new TJUSA logo online I received two e-mails, one from Happy Tom and another from El Presidente, Turbojugend St. Pauli. Tom expressed how much he liked the design while El Presidente, on the other hand, questioned my motives for incorporating the 'iron cross' into the motif. Well being the negro obsessed guy that I am, I thought the answer was pretty clear. But as I soon found out not everybody thinks along the same lines as I do and thinks of 'Bad Mongo' when they see an 'iron cross'. And besides the standard 'badge and cap' was set and there were no other jugend chapters breaking with 'tradition' so why was I?

Well, for whatever reason I chose not to convert to the 'b & c' but instead ran with my own design. A decision that even today is a great source of controversy. But that's another story...

Future...

With the exception of a handful of chapters not much activity was seen by Turbojugend during the years following the band's breakup in 1998. That was all to change when the band made a comeback in 2002 with what is known as the 'Res-Erection' tour. Now, six years later and thousands of chapters around the globe the idea of the 'personalized / localized' crest is fast becoming a more common occurrence. Ironically this seems to go with the band's new image. An image of six individuals each with their own persona that together make up the rock-n-roll machine: Turbonegro!
